Breathing is a standard need, yet lung health often goes undetected until problems emerge. Pulmonologists, likewise called lung physicians, are specialized medical professionals educated to diagnose, treat, and take care of conditions influencing the respiratory system. From bronchial asthma to persistent obstructive pulmonary illness (COPD), these specialists are crucial for addressing lung-related problems and ensuring long-lasting health and wellness.


What Is Pulmonology?


Pulmonology is a branch of inner medicine that focuses on identifying and dealing with conditions entailing the lungs, airways, and breathing muscular tissues. It plays an essential function in keeping the body's oxygen supply and addressing diseases that affect breathing. Pulmonology likewise overlaps with rest medication, offered the respiratory system's vital function throughout rest.

Tests and Diagnostic Tools Used by Pulmonologists


1. FeNO Testing


Fractional Exhaled Nitric Oxide (FeNO screening) is a non-invasive test that gauges air passage inflammation brought on by asthma or various other breathing conditions. It's particularly helpful for validating an asthma medical diagnosis or keeping an eye on how well a therapy strategy is functioning. Clients with suspected asthma can profit considerably from a FeNO examination for bronchial asthma to ensure the condition is appropriately identified and dealt with.


2. Pulse Oximetry Test


A pulse oximetry examination steps blood oxygen degrees. It's a fast and painless technique to establish how well your lungs are providing click here oxygen to the blood stream. During physical activities, a pulse oximetry workout examination is often utilized to check oxygen saturation and evaluate whether extra oxygen is needed.


3. Polysomnography Test


Also referred to as a sleep research study, a polysomnography examination assesses breathing, oxygen levels, and other crucial indicators throughout rest. This examination is essential for diagnosing conditions like obstructive sleep apnea, which can considerably affect quality of life and general health and wellness if left without treatment.


4. Imaging Tests and Bronchoscopies


Pulmonologists additionally rely upon imaging devices like upper body X-rays, CT scans, and bronchoscopy treatments to picture the lungs and determine structural problems or clogs.



Usual Conditions Treated by Pulmonologists


Pulmonologists take care of a variety of respiratory system conditions and conditions, including:



  • Asthma: A chronic problem that triggers air passage inflammation and trouble breathing.

  • Persistent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D): A modern disease often brought on by cigarette smoking, characterized by persistent breathing troubles.

  • Sleep Apnea: A problem where breathing continuously stops and begins during rest, commonly identified with a polysomnography examination.

  • Pulmonary Fibrosis: A condition where lung cells ends up being scarred and rigid, making it difficult to take a breath.

  • Lung Cancer: Pulmonologists play a role in detecting and handling treatment prepare for lung cancer cells individuals.

  • Pneumonia: An infection that irritates the air sacs in the lungs, bring about signs like coughing, high temperature, and difficulty breathing.

How Pulmonologists Treat Respiratory Conditions


Treatment plans from pulmonologists frequently integrate medical therapies, lifestyle adjustments, and advanced procedures.



  • Medications: Bronchodilators, corticosteroids, and antibiotics are typically recommended to take care of signs and symptoms and deal with infections.

  • Oxygen Therapy: For problems like COPD, oxygen treatment guarantees sufficient oxygen levels in the blood.

  • Pulmonary Rehabilitation: An organized program of workout and education designed to boost lung feature and general quality of life.

  • Surgical Interventions: In severe instances, procedures like lung transplants or elimination of unhealthy lung tissue might be essential.
